In this article, we’ll review the various kinds of resume formats as well as some tips to select which one is most suitable for you.
- Reverse-Chronological: This format is the most common and is the best for those with a solid work history. It lists your work experience in reverse-chronological order, with your most recent job at the top.
- Functional: This style is suitable for those with multiple or non-linear working experience. It focuses on your skills and achievements, not the work experience.
- Combination: This format combines elements of the reverse-chronological and functional formats. It highlights your skills and accomplishments, while also listing your work history in reverse-chronological order.
- Customize it for the job Tailor your resume format to match the job you’re applying for. Make sure you choose a format that highlights the abilities and experience which are most relevant for the position.

Each of the above formats have their own pros and disadvantages. The reverse-chronological format is best for those with a solid work history, the functional format is best for those with diverse or non-linear work experience, and the combination format is a good balance of both.
